Touring cycling in Neustadt an der Aisch-Bad Windsheim is characterized by diverse landscapes, including the Aisch River valley, rolling hills, and extensive woodlands. The region encompasses parts of the Steigerwald and Frankenhöhe nature parks, offering varied terrain for cyclists. Paths often lead through charming Franconian villages and past historical sites.

The Weinparadiesscheune (Wine Paradise Barn) stands precisely on the border between Lower and Middle Franconia. Surrounded by forest and vineyards, it offers a view of the vineyards of Bullenheim and Seinsheim. The restaurant is open Wednesdays to Fridays from 1 p.m. to 10 p.m., and Saturdays, Sundays, and public holidays from noon to 10 p.m.

Yes, the region is well-suited for family cycling. The Aisch Valley Cycle Path is particularly noted for being family-friendly, with minimal inclines, well-developed paths, and low traffic. Many of the 648 easy routes available in the area are also great for families.

The most pleasant time for touring cycling in Neustadt an der Aisch-Bad Windsheim is typically from spring through autumn. During these seasons, the weather is generally mild, and the landscapes are at their most vibrant, offering ideal conditions for exploring the region's diverse routes.
Yes, many routes in the region are designed as circular tours, allowing you to start and end at the same point. For example, the Obere Aischrunde is a moderate 38.3 km loop that explores the upper Aisch River, offering a mix of rural scenery and village exploration.
The area is high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.5 stars from over 5000 reviews. Reviewers often praise the diverse landscapes, well-developed paths, and the charming Franconian villages encountered along the routes. The mix of easy and challenging options also contributes to its popularity.
Yes, the region is known for its hospitality. Many routes pass through charming Franconian villages and towns like Neustadt an der Aisch, where you'll find opportunities for rest in traditional beer gardens or local restaurants. The Voggendorfer Keller Beer Garden is one such spot.
For experienced riders seeking longer distances, routes like the Bocksbeutelrunde offer a challenging 98.6 km ride with significant elevation changes. The region has 363 difficult routes, providing ample options for those looking for a more strenuous cycling adventure.

Absolutely. The Aischgründer Bierrunde, for instance, is a 64.6 km route that allows you to explore the local brewing traditions of the Aischgrund region. Another option is the Zenngründer Museumsrunde, which leads through the Zenngrund region, often connecting to local museums and cultural sites.
There are over 1900 touring cycling routes available in Neustadt an der Aisch-Bad Windsheim, catering to various skill levels and preferences. This includes 648 easy, 895 moderate, and 363 difficult routes.
While many outdoor areas in the region are dog-friendly, it's always recommended to keep your dog on a leash, especially in nature reserves or near wildlife. Ensure you carry enough water for both yourself and your pet, and be mindful of other cyclists and pedestrians.
Yes, the diverse landscapes, particularly in the hilly sections of the Steigerwald and Frankenhöhe nature parks, offer numerous picturesque views. Routes like the Tour of the senses provide scenic views through the Franconian landscape, allowing you to enjoy the rolling hills and woodlands.
